Hectic consultations in BJP headquarters on Karnataka Governor's recommendations

Hectic consultations are on in the BJP headquarters in New Delhi over Karnataka Governor's recommendations for imposition of President's rule in the State. The brain storming session is being chaired by Party President Nitin Gadkari. Consultations are also on with the NDA partners on the issue.Karnataka Chief Minister B.S. Yeddyurappa arrived in New Delhi on Monday night along with the BJP MLAs, MPs and MLCs. Mr. Yeddyurappa is to meet President Pratibha Devisingh Patil this evening and parade MLAs before her claiming his majority in the State. Talking to reporters on his arrival, Mr. Yeddyurappa alleged that the Karnataka Governor has been trying to destabilise his government right from the beginning. The National Democratic Alliance has demanded recall of Karnataka Governor H.R. Bhardwaj for recommending President's rule in the state. NDA, led by senior BJP leader L.K.Advani met Prime Minister Manmohan Singh in New Delhi on Monday and demanded rejection of any such recommendation alleging it as an unconstitutional act of the governor. Mr. Advani said that the Prime Minister had assured him that no unconstitutional step would be taken with regard to Karnataka developments.The Karnataka Governor has sent his recommendations to the President after the Supreme Court quashed the disqualification of 11 BJP and five independent legislators by the Speaker of the Karnataka Assembly in October last.
